A data set has values 2 (8 times), 5 (12 times), and 7 (4 times). What is the mean?

Explanation:
Mean is the average value, found by adding up all data points and dividing by how many data points there are. When a value appears several times, treat each appearance as a separate data point and weight accordingly. Here, multiply each value by its frequency and add: 2 appears 8 times contributes 2 × 8 = 16 5 appears 12 times contributes 5 × 12 = 60 7 appears 4 times contributes 7 × 4 = 28 Sum of all values = 16 + 60 + 28 = 104. Total number of observations = 8 + 12 + 4 = 24. So the mean is 104 divided by 24, which equals 104/24 = 4.333..., or about 4.33. This result reflects the frequencies in the data, giving more weight to the value 5 because it appears most often.
